Saakashvili quarreled with Majlis-Maidan propagandists
The “great reformer” Mikheil Saakashvili offended prominent Mejlis-Maidan propagandists.
The reason was Saakashvili’s participation on the air of two TV channels - the Majlis ATR and ZIK, owned by the mayor of Lvov Andrei Sadovoy.
In both cases, Saakashvili got into an altercation with TV presenters who asked awkward questions. The fugitive Georgian ex-president said that the journalists are working off the “dungeons” of the administration of Petro Poroshenko.
Saakashvili’s Kyiv propagandists could not forgive such an insult.

One of the leaders of ATR, Aider Muzhdabaev, published a video today showing that in interviews with Western media, Saakashvili never allowed journalists to be blamed, despite pressing questions.
“Post-Soviet politicians there know perfectly well the rules of communication with the press. And they behave on air like bunnies, even their facial expressions are completely different. They are afraid of Western journalists, respect Western viewers, but not their own journalists and viewers. If they had tried to behave there like they did here, I don’t even know what the interviewers would have done with them. More precisely, I know. And they know. Double standards in everything. And this applies not only to Saakashvili, look at the interviews of our other politicians - the same thing. For them, their people are cattle. This is the answer to the main question, why everything here is not the same as in the West,” wrote Muzhdabaev.
